Detection
Depending on the response sensitivity set on the detector module (0.5%/m to 2%/m light
obscuration), the FCS-320-TM-R triggers the main alarm when the appropriate light
obscuration is reached. The sensitivities can also be set at intervals of 0.1%/m using the
FAS-ASD-DIAG diagnostic software. The alarm is displayed via the alarm display on the unit
and forwarded to the fire panel connected. The alarm thresholds and the display and
transmission of malfunctions can be allocated different delay times. The intelligent
LOGIC·SENS signal processing hides misleading values that are similar to those shown in the
event of a fire, and ensures a high level of security against deceptive alarms.
Alternative sensitivity
The FAS-ASD-DIAG diagnostic software allows the sensitivity set on the detection unit to be
changed if necessary.
Monitoring unit
The detection unit is monitored for contamination and for signal malfunction. A malfunction is
displayed on the unit and forwarded to the fire panel. Malfunctions caused by brief
environmental fluctuations can be eliminated with a time-delayed setting.
Airflow monitoring
An airflow sensor checks the connected pipe system for breakage and obstruction.
The airflow sensor can – depending on the configuration of the pipe system (see
Section 3.2 Principles of Pipe Planning, page 32) and the setting of the airflow sensors - detect
an obstruction of a single air sampling opening. The airflow monitoring is temperature-
compensated and can be set depending on the air pressure.
On expiry of a defined delay, the malfunction is displayed on the aspirating smoke detector
and the message is transmitted to the fire panel. The monitoring window thresholds can be
modified to suit the environmental conditions (see Section 3.3 Airflow monitoring, page 34).
